3DescriptionCVE.org
@better-auth/sso versions before 1.6.21 contain multiple authentication bypass vulnerabilities in SSO provider handling that allow attackers to sign in as arbitrary users. Attackers can exploit domain verification parsing mismatches, orphaned provider accounts, unbound SAML assertions, or reflected XSS on logout endpoints to gain unauthorized session access and account takeover.

| Exploit Scenario | An attacker holding a low-privilege account on a Better Auth application with SSO enabled crafts a SAML response with an assertion that is not cryptographically bound to the originating authentication request, targeting a high-value user account. The vulnerable library accepts the unbound assertion and issues a session token for the victim account, granting the attacker full account control. … |
| Remediation | Upgrade @better-auth/sso to version 1.6.21 or later on the stable track, or to 1.7.0-beta.10 or later on the beta track, per the vendor advisory GHSA-prpr-5gj3-qqhg at https://github.com/better-auth/better-auth/security/advisories/GHSA-prpr-5gj3-qqhg. … Detailed patch versions, workarounds, and compensating controls in full report. |
